Annual short term debt:
$690.00M+$312.00M(+82.54%)Summary
- As of today (May 29, 2025), OVV annual short term debt is $690.00 million, with the most recent change of +$312.00 million (+82.54%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, OVV annual short term debt has risen by +$622.00 million (+914.71%).
- OVV annual short term debt is now -35.27% below its all-time high of $1.07 billion, reached on December 31, 2013.

quarterly short term debt:
$1.25B+$556.00M(+80.58%)Summary
- As of today (May 29, 2025), OVV quarterly short term debt is $1.25 billion, with the most recent change of +$556.00 million (+80.58%) on March 31, 2025.
- Over the past year, OVV quarterly short term debt has increased by +$423.00 million (+51.40%).
- OVV quarterly short term debt is now -39.31% below its all-time high of $2.05 billion, reached on September 30, 2011.

Short term debt Formula
Short-Term Debt = Current Portion of Long-Term Debt + Short-Term Loans + Commercial Paper + Other Short-Term Borrowings
